Chat OnlineAug 26 2019 · Magnetic Properties of Materials Magnetic Properties of MaterialsFrom the magnetic point of view a material is classified according to the nature of its relative permeability (μ r). All nonmagnetic materials are classified as paramagnetic μ r slightly greater than 1 and diamagnetic μ r slightly less than 1.

Chat OnlineSection 15 Magnetic properties of materials Definition of fundamental quantities When a material medium is placed in a magnetic field the medium is magnetized. This magnetization is described by the magnetization vector M the dipole moment per unit volume.

Chat OnlineIn unmagnetized materials magnetic domains face in different directions canceling each other out. Whereas in magnetized materials most of these domains are aligned pointing in the same direction which creates a magnetic field. The more domains that align together the stronger the magnetic force.
